What is Cosmetology

Hinsdale IL client with cucumber facialCosmetology is a profession that is all about making the human anatomy look more beautiful through the use of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that a number of c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be almost an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, most states mandate that you take some kind of specialized training and then become licensed. Once you are licensed, the work settings include not only Hinsdale IL beauty salons and barber shops, but also such venues as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have acquired experience and a clientele, open their own shops or salons. Others will start servicing clients either in their own residences or will travel to the client’s house, or both. As earlier mentioned, in the majority of states practicing cosmetologists have to be licensed. In a few states there is an exception. Only those performing more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, which include shampooers, are not required to be licensed in those states.

Esthetics Degrees and Certificates

esthetics facial toners Hinsdale ILThere are basically two options available to receive esthetician training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s usually take 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the main are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are available if you wish to focus on just one area, for instance esthetics. A degree program will also most likely feature management and marketing training in order that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Hinsdale IL business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whatever type of training program you decide on, it’s essential to make sure that it’s certified by the Illinois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only certify schools that are accredited by certain respected organizations,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Esthetician Training

Hinsdale IL student attending online esthetician classesOnline esthetician schools are convenient for Hinsdale IL students who are employed full-time and have family responsibilities that make it challenging to attend a more traditional school. There are a large number of web-based beauty school programs available that can be attended through a home comput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ional cosmetology schools are often fast paced due to the fact that many programs are as brief as six or eight months. This means that a significant portion of time is spent in the classroom. With online courses, you are dealing with the same volume of material, but you’re not spending many hours outside of your home or driving back and forth from classes. However, it’s important that the school you pick can provide internship training in area salons and parlors to ensure that you also obtain the hands-on training required for a comprehensive education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ology profession. So be sure if you decide to enroll in an online school to verify that internship training is available in your area.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s important to make certain that the esthetician school you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ards assu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for securing student loans or financial aid, which often are not offered in 60521 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, a number of Hinsdale IL employers will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

Is Any Hands-On Training Provided?  Learning and perfecting esthetician skills and techniques requires lots of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is included in the cosmetology classes you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that allow students to practice their growing skills on real people. If a beauty school provides minimal or no scheduled live training, but instead depends predominantly on utilizing mannequins, it may not be the best option for cultivating your skills. So try to find alternate schools that provide this type of training.

    Hinsdale, Illinois

    Hinsdale is a village in Cook and DuPage counties in the U.S. state of Illinois. Hinsdale is a western suburb of Chicago. The population was 16,816 at the 2010 census, most of whom lived in DuPage County.[3] The town's ZIP code is 60521, and it is listed in the top 1% of wealthiest towns in Illinois. It is known locally for its beautiful residences and teardown culture, of which new rebuilds have taken 30% of homes in the village. The town has a rolling, wooded topography, with a quaint downtown, and is a 22-minute express train ride to downtown Chicago on the Burlington Northern line.

    Hinsdale is located 20 miles (32 km) west of Chicago and is bordered by Western Springs to the east, Clarendon Hills and Westmont to the west, Oak Brook to the north, and Burr Ridge and Willowbrook to the south. It can be reached by highway from Interstate 294 or Interstate 55. The eastern boundary of Hinsdale is I-294, and the western boundary is Route 83.

    According to the 2010 census, Hinsdale has a total area of 4.633 square miles (12.00 km2), of which 4.6 square miles (11.91 km2) (or 99.29%) is land and 0.033 square miles (0.09 km2) (or 0.71%) is water.[4]
